Account Executive is a senior level role responsible for value delivery, relationship development, and overall account growth of BHI products and services with participating BCBS Plans and key external partners. The role requires a strong consultative, relationship-focused, and growth-oriented approach, experience in developing relationships with health care payers, and knowledge of analytic and data science solutions and health plan operations such as care management, medical economics, provider relations/network management and enterprise reporting.
The Account Executive will build on their knowledge and industry experience to define and measure value delivery, ensure client success in their use of BHI products and services, and support overall account growth objectives (revenue and otherwise). In this role, the Account Executive will work to understand the Plan’s key business drivers, development areas, and competitive threats, demonstrate how BHI’s products and services will support and meet those needs, and provide “real-life” examples of how BHI account Plans use our solutions to solve problems and improve delivery of health care.
